JavaScript中文参考手册


JavaScript是一种广泛应用于Web开发的脚本语言,由Netscape公司的Brendan Eich在1995年创造,最初命名为LiveScript。它并非与Java有关,而是基于ECMAScript规范,现在主要由Mozilla基金会的Mozilla开发联盟维护。JavaScript主要用于网页和网络应用,可以实现动态内容、用户交互、页面动画、数据验证以及服务器通信等功能。 这份“JavaScript中文参考手册”是一份详尽的指南,旨在帮助中文使用者深入理解和掌握JavaScript的核心概念和语法。手册涵盖了以下几个关键知识点: 1. **基础语法**:包括变量声明(var, let, const)、数据类型(如字符串、数字、布尔值、null、undefined、对象、数组和符号)、运算符(算术、比较、逻辑、赋值等)以及流程控制(条件语句、循环语句)。 2. **函数**:JavaScript中的函数是第一类对象,可以作为参数传递,也可以作为返回值。函数表达式、函数声明、箭头函数和作用域规则都是重要的部分。 3. **对象和原型**:JavaScript采用基于原型的继承机制,对象可以通过构造函数创建,原型链是理解对象继承的关键。此外,还涉及到对象字面量、属性访问、对象方法以及`this`关键字。 4. **数组和集合**:JavaScript提供了多种处理序列数据的数据结构,如数组、Set和Map。数组的方法(如push、pop、slice、forEach等)以及ES6引入的新特性如解构赋值、扩展运算符等是学习重点。 5. **字符串和正则表达式**:字符串是不可变的,提供了丰富的操作方法。正则表达式用于模式匹配,是处理文本的强大工具。 6. **事件和DOM操作**:JavaScript能够通过事件监听来响应用户交互,DOM(Document Object Model)是HTML和XML文档的抽象表示,用于操作页面元素。 7. **异步编程**:包括回调函数、Promise、async/await等,用于处理非阻塞I/O和提高程序性能。 8. **模块系统**:ES6引入了模块系统,允许代码组织和重用,通过`import`和`export`关键字进行导入和导出。 9. **错误处理**:通过try/catch语句捕获和处理运行时错误,了解常见的JavaScript错误类型也是很重要的。 10. **ES6及后续版本新特性**:包括箭头函数、模板字符串、解构赋值、类、生成器、Async/Await等,这些都是现代JavaScript开发的必备知识。 这份中文参考手册将对这些内容进行详细阐述,并提供实例和解释,帮助初学者快速上手,同时对有经验的开发者来说,也是查找和巩固知识点的好资源。无论你是前端开发者还是全栈工程师,JavaScript都是不可或缺的一部分,这份手册会是你学习和工作中宝贵的参考资料。



















- 1


- 粉丝: 0
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助


最新资源
- 威士葡萄酒网络营销策划方案.doc
- 中国网络游戏产业全景调查报告.doc
- 电子技术C语言课程设计题目.doc
- 实用软件工程ch10.pptx
- 小学英语海伦凯勒-Helen-Keler信息化说课.ppt
- 嵌入式系统在船舶方面的应用.doc
- 纸质2012年6月份PMP模拟试题第三套(带答案).doc
- 目前最详细的中文sas软件教程第五卷(共五卷).pdf
- 新编软件定制开发协议.doc
- 中国打车软件行业分析.pptx
- 室内综合布线工程设计报告样本.doc
- 用友软件:年结流程、跨年业务处理规则.pdf
- 计算机网络故障诊断与维护讲义.ppt
- 录制微课的软件介绍.ppt
- 软件工程大四社会实践报告.docx
- 我国电子商务的逃税问题及对策.docx


